THE LEATHERCRAFT GUILD

c/o ROBERT AMBRIZ

PO BOX 4603

Ontario, CA 91761-4603

Robert Ambriz, President

Wayne Christensen, Vice President

leatherguild@verizon.net

Website: http://www.theleathercraftguild.com

The Leathercraft Guild meets the third Sunday of each month from 1PM - 4PM

We currently have 2 meeting places…

The Garvey Center 9108 Garvey Avenue, Rosemead, CA. 91770

Standing Bear's Trading Post 7624 Tampa Avenue, Reseda, CA. 91335.

inquiry@sbearstradingpost.com

All interested parties are most welcome to attend, share, learn and enjoy our

wonderful art form. We will also exchange newsletters with other Guilds.
